  RTE flow items & actions use positive values in item & action type.
Negative values are reserved for PMD private types. PMD
items & actions usually are not exposed to application and are not
used to create RTE flows.

The patch allows applications with access to PMD flow
items & actions ability to integrate RTE and PMD items & actions
and use them to create flow rule.

RTE flow item or action conversion library accepts positive known
element types with predefined sizes only. Private PMD items and
actions do not fit into this scheme because PMD type values are
negative, each PMD has it's own types numeration and element types and
their sizes are not visible at RTE level.  To resolve these
limitations the patch proposes this solution:
1. PMD can expose elements of pointer size only.  RTE flow
   conversion functions will use pointer size for each configuration
   object in private PMD element it processes;
2. RTE flow verification will not reject elements with negative type.
